Underground Genesis: Hacker Culture and Early Digital Manipulation (1980s-1990s)

The foundations of internet deception were laid not by malicious actors or foreign governments, but by a colorful cast of teenage hackers and computer enthusiasts who viewed the emerging digital landscape as an infinite playground for creativity and mischief. During the 1980s and early 1990s, when most Americans had never touched a computer, these digital pioneers were already discovering that information networks could be powerful tools for storytelling, pranks, and social commentary that challenged traditional notions of authority and truth. The hacker underground of this era operated through bulletin board systems, where pseudonymous figures with handles like "The Mentor" and "Erik Bloodaxe" shared not just technical knowledge, but elaborate fictional narratives disguised as real experiences. These "textfiles" became the internet's first viral content, spreading stories of UFO conspiracies, corporate infiltration, and government secrets that blended just enough technical accuracy with outrageous fiction to captivate readers and establish new forms of digital mythology. What made these early digital deceptions so effective was their exploitation of information asymmetry. In an era when few people understood computer technology, hackers could craft elaborate narratives about their capabilities that were impossible to verify. When mainstream media outlets came looking for stories about the "hacker menace," they found communities ready to perform exactly the kind of technological theater that would captivate audiences while simultaneously mocking the very concept of authoritative reporting. This period established enduring patterns that would persist throughout the digital age: the use of technological complexity to obscure truth, the power of compelling narratives to override factual accuracy, and the ability of underground communities to shape mainstream perceptions through strategic performance. These early hackers weren't primarily motivated by malice, but by the intoxicating possibility of transcending physical limitations through technology, inadvertently creating the template for all future forms of digital manipulation and reality alteration.

The Photoshop Revolution: Democratizing Visual Reality Alteration (1990s-2000s)

The release of Adobe Photoshop in 1990 marked a pivotal moment in the democratization of image manipulation, transforming what had once been the exclusive domain of professional darkroom technicians into a tool accessible to anyone with a personal computer. This shift represented more than just technological progress; it fundamentally altered humanity's relationship with visual truth and established the foundation for our current era of widespread digital manipulation. The Knoll brothers, who developed the core algorithms that became Photoshop, initially conceived their software as a tool for enhancing and correcting photographs rather than fabricating entirely new realities. However, users quickly discovered that the same techniques used to adjust brightness or remove dust spots could be employed to seamlessly insert objects, delete inconvenient details, or create entirely fictional scenes. The software's intuitive interface meant that complex manipulations that once required years of darkroom expertise could now be accomplished by amateurs in minutes. As Photoshop evolved throughout the 1990s and early 2000s, it spawned new forms of creative expression and cultural commentary. Websites like Something Awful's "Photoshop Phriday" turned image manipulation into a form of collaborative art, where users would compete to create the most outrageous or clever alterations of photographs. These communities developed their own aesthetics and conventions, establishing visual languages that would later influence meme culture and digital art, proving that the most successful manipulated images weren't trying to fool anyone but rather served as vehicles for humor and social commentary. The true revolution came with the realization that Photoshop had made the concept of photographic truth obsolete. Every digital image became potentially suspect, requiring viewers to develop new forms of visual literacy and critical thinking. This transformation laid the groundwork for our current era of deepfakes and AI-generated content, establishing the principle that in the digital realm, seeing is no longer necessarily believing, and that emotional authenticity often trumps technical authenticity in determining what content resonates with audiences.

Social Media Amplification: Viral Fakery and Algorithmic Distribution (2000s-2010s)

As social media platforms emerged and smartphones put powerful cameras in everyone's pockets, the creation and sharing of manipulated content shifted from specialized communities to the general public, marking the transition from isolated acts of digital creativity to a global phenomenon of "participatory fakery" where millions of users simultaneously created, modified, and redistributed visual content on an unprecedented scale. The rise of platforms like Facebook, Instagram, and Twitter coincided with increasingly sophisticated yet user-friendly editing tools, suddenly enabling anyone to apply filters, merge images, or create composite scenes with minimal technical knowledge. More importantly, these platforms' algorithms rewarded engaging content regardless of its authenticity, creating powerful incentives for increasingly outrageous and attention-grabbing posts that prioritized emotional impact over factual accuracy. This era witnessed the emergence of coordinated disinformation campaigns, as political actors recognized the potential of user-generated fake content to influence public opinion and democratic processes. However, the most successful examples weren't sophisticated deepfakes or carefully crafted propaganda, but crude memes that tapped into existing cultural anxieties and tribal identities. The 2016 election cycle demonstrated how amateur content creators could produce material more influential than professional media organizations, revealing the power of authentic emotional resonance over technical sophistication. The period culminated with the development of AI-powered content generation tools and early versions of what would become deepfake technology. Yet even as these tools grew more sophisticated, the most impactful fake content remained decidedly low-tech, teaching us that in the attention economy of social media, emotional authenticity trumped technical authenticity. The lesson was clear: the most powerful fakes were often the most obviously fabricated ones, succeeding not through deception but through their ability to express shared cultural sentiments and tribal affiliations in compelling visual form.

AI-Generated Future: Deep Learning and Synthetic Media Era (2010s-Present)

The arrival of deepfake technology in 2017 seemed to herald a new era of perfect digital deception, where anyone could create convincing videos of public figures saying or doing anything imaginable. Media coverage suggested we were entering an "information apocalypse" where truth itself would become unknowable, yet the reality proved more complex and, in many ways, more mundane than these dire predictions suggested, revealing fundamental insights about how humans actually interact with synthetic media. While deepfake technology did advance rapidly, driven by improvements in artificial intelligence and machine learning, its practical impact remained limited by technical barriers and resource requirements. The most sophisticated fake videos required significant expertise and computational power, keeping them largely confined to academic research and specialized communities. Meanwhile, the fake content actually influencing political discourse remained surprisingly crude, consisting of obviously manipulated memes, recycled conspiracy theories, and amateur hoaxes that succeeded through emotional appeal rather than technical sophistication. The COVID-19 pandemic accelerated many of these trends, as lockdowns drove more human interaction into digital spaces while simultaneously creating unprecedented uncertainty and anxiety. Fake content flourished not because it was becoming more believable, but because people were increasingly willing to believe content that confirmed their existing worldviews or provided simple explanations for complex problems, demonstrating that the challenge wasn't technological but psychological and cultural. Perhaps most significantly, this period revealed that the threat of perfect fakes might be less important than the mere possibility of their existence. Politicians and public figures learned to dismiss inconvenient evidence by simply claiming it might be fake, regardless of its actual authenticity. The deepfake era taught us that in information warfare, the weapon isn't necessarily the fake content itself, but the doubt it casts on everything else, fundamentally altering how societies process and evaluate information in ways that extend far beyond the technology's actual capabilities.

Summary

Throughout this four-decade technological evolution, one pattern emerges clearly: the human impulse to create and consume fictional content isn't a bug in our information systems, but a fundamental feature of how we make sense of the world, express creativity, and build shared cultural understanding. From ancient cave paintings to internet memes, humans have always used creative media to explore possibilities, express anxieties, and construct meaning from chaos, revealing that our current information challenges aren't primarily technological problems requiring technological solutions, but cultural phenomena demanding cultural responses. The history of digital fakery demonstrates that the most effective fake content succeeds not because it's technically sophisticated, but because it resonates with existing beliefs, fears, and desires, tapping into deeper currents of human psychology and social identity. This insight suggests that rather than futilely attempting to eliminate all fake content through detection algorithms or platform policies, we should focus on promoting media literacy, supporting quality journalism, and fostering online communities that value truth and constructive dialogue while acknowledging the legitimate role of creative expression and cultural commentary. Moving forward, we need approaches that harness the creative potential of digital manipulation technologies while minimizing their capacity for harm. This means developing educational frameworks that help people distinguish between malicious deception and legitimate creative expression, supporting institutions that can provide authoritative information during crises, and creating social norms that reward thoughtful engagement over viral sensationalism. The goal isn't to return to some imagined golden age of information purity, but to build systems that embrace human creativity while protecting the shared foundations of truth that democratic societies require to function effectively in an increasingly complex digital landscape.
